Setting the Project Cursor Position
You have several possibilities to set the project cursor position, that is, to locate to specic time
positions in the Project window.
By using the main transport functions.
By holding down Shift-Alt and clicking in the event display.
By clicking or dragging in the lower part of the ruler.
By using the functions in the Set Project Cursor Position submenu of the Transport
menu.
By clicking in an empty section in the event display.
NOTE
For this to work you must activate Locate when Clicked in Empty Space in the
Preferences dialog (Transport page).
By using locators.
NOTE
You can use Num1 to set the project cursor to the left locator position, and Num2 to set
the project cursor to the right locator position.
By using markers.
Cubase Elements only: By using the arranger functions.
By using key commands.
